Comprehensive Protection for Wind Energy Workers

The wind energy sector demands head-to-toe protection for workers who operate in harsh conditions and demanding environments. Essential protective equipment includes:

  • Head Protection: Helmets and hard hats are crucial for safeguarding against impact and electrical hazards, ensuring the safety of workers in high-risk areas.
  • Eye and Face Protection: Safety glasses and face shields offer superior protection against flying debris, dust, and harmful UV rays, allowing workers to perform their tasks with confidence.
  • Hearing Protection: Earplugs and earmuffs are designed to reduce noise exposure, preventing hearing loss and ensuring clear communication in noisy environments.
  • Respiratory Protection: Respirators and masks provide effective protection against airborne contaminants, ensuring clean and breathable air for workers.
  • Hand Protection: Gloves are essential for providing excellent grip, dexterity, and protection against cuts, abrasions, and chemical exposure.
  • Fall Protection: Harnesses, lanyards, and anchor points are engineered to provide maximum safety and comfort for workers at height, reducing the risk of falls and injuries.
  • Protective Clothing: Flame-resistant garments, high-visibility vests, and weather-resistant outerwear ensure workers are protected in all conditions.
